How Can Limit Switches Transform Your Automation Efficiency and Reliability?
In the realm of industrial automation, limit switches play a crucial role in enhancing efficiency and reliability. These devices serve as essential components in various machinery and systems, providing precise control for operational processes. By understanding the significance of limit switches, manufacturers can optimize their automation workflows and achieve better outcomes.

Limit switches operate primarily by detecting the presence or absence of an object within a machine or system. When an object reaches a predetermined position, the limit switch activates, sending a signal to either halt or modify the machinery's operations. This capability is particularly beneficial in applications such as conveyor systems, robotic arms, and automated assembly lines. The primary features of limit switches include mechanical actuation, variety in operating styles (such as snap-action or slow-make), and the ability to work under varying environmental conditions, which is important for robust industrial settings.
However, like any technology, limit switches have their pros and cons. On the positive side, limit switches enhance safety by preventing machinery from operating beyond specified limits, thus minimizing risks and potential accidents. Additionally, their straightforward design ensures ease of installation and maintenance, making them user-friendly. Yet, there are some drawbacks to consider. For instance, mechanical wear over time can cause reliability issues, and certain types might be less effective in harsh environments unless adequately protected or designed for such conditions.

When it comes to pricing, limit switches typically range from $10 to $200, depending on the type, features, and brand. While basic models are affordably priced, higher-end options equipped with advanced features—such as better environmental resistance or integrated digital outputs—can be more costly. Evaluating the cost-effectiveness of these devices involves considering the potential for reduced downtime and increased operational efficiency they bring. In many cases, the initial investment in high-quality limit switches pays off by lowering maintenance costs and improving productivity.
